Introduction

Practice questions are an essential part of exam preparation. They allow you to test your knowledge, identify areas where you need improvement, and develop the skills necessary to succeed in the actual exam. This chapter provides a comprehensive guide to practice questions, including:

  • Types of practice questions
  • How to make the most of practice questions
  • Tips for answering questions effectively
  • Time management strategies

Types of Practice Questions

There are various types of practice questions available, each designed to assess different aspects of your knowledge and skills. Common types of practice questions include:

1. Subject-wise Practice Questions:

These questions are specific to a particular subject or topic. They cover the core concepts, theories, and principles of the subject. Solving subject-wise practice questions helps you:

  • Reinforce your understanding of the material
  • Identify areas where you need additional study
  • Develop your problem-solving skills

2. Mock Tests and Sample Papers:

Mock tests and sample papers simulate the actual exam experience. They typically consist of a set of questions covering the entire syllabus. Solving mock tests and sample papers helps you:

  • Familiarize yourself with the exam format and structure
  • Practice answering questions under timed conditions
  • Identify potential challenges and areas for improvement

3. Timed Practice Questions:

Timed practice questions are designed to help you develop your time management skills. They require you to complete a set number of questions within a specific time limit. By solving timed practice questions, you can:

  • Improve your ability to work under pressure
  • Learn to allocate time effectively
  • Reduce stress and anxiety during the actual exam

How to Make the Most of Practice Questions

To make the most of practice questions, follow these guidelines:

1. Start Early:

Begin practicing as early as possible. Start with subject-wise practice questions and gradually move on to mock tests and sample papers.

2. Solve Regularly:

Set aside dedicated time each day or week for practicing questions. Regular practice is crucial for improving your skills and confidence.

3. Review Your Answers:

After solving each practice question, take time to review your answers. Identify why you got the question correct or incorrect. This helps you understand your strengths and weaknesses.

4. Don't Get Discouraged:

It's natural to encounter difficult questions or make mistakes while practicing. Don't get discouraged; instead, use these experiences as opportunities to learn and improve.

Tips for Answering Questions Effectively

Here are some tips to help you answer practice questions effectively:

1. Read the Question Carefully:

Make sure you understand the question before you start answering. Identify the key terms and concepts.

2. Organize Your Thoughts:

Before writing your answer, take a few moments to organize your thoughts. This will help you provide a clear and concise response.

3. Show Your Work:

When solving numerical or mathematical questions, show your work step by step. This demonstrates your understanding and helps you identify any errors.

4. Don't Guess:

If you don't know the answer to a question, don't guess. Instead, skip it and come back to it later. Guessing can lead to incorrect answers and waste time.

Time Management Strategies

Effective time management is crucial for success in exams. Here are some strategies to help you allocate your time wisely during practice questions:

1. Divide and Conquer:

Break down large sets of questions into smaller, manageable chunks. This makes the task less daunting and helps you focus.

2. Prioritize Questions:

Start with the questions you find easier or are more confident about. This will boost your confidence and help you manage your time effectively.

3. Use Timed Practice Questions:

Solve timed practice questions to get a sense of how long each type of question takes. This will help you allocate your time wisely in the actual exam.

4. Take Breaks:

Regular breaks are essential for maintaining focus and preventing burnout. Take short breaks every 30-45 minutes to refresh your mind.
